    One good use for capacitors in car audio is noise suppression, and I picked up a 2 farad electrolytic cap for this purpose. Put in parallel as close to amps as I can, the .01 ohm resistance of the wire running from the front makes a 8hz 6db/Oct lowpass filter. This removed the alternator whine I was getting, and also lowered the noise floor abit.
